# Group Functions

A group is made up of people with different functions in relation to the group. For example they might be a team leader or an attendee.

For information purposes infoodle allows you to display the function that each member has.

To assign a function to a group member:

1. From the Group page click on **edit** next to the person you want to add a Group Function to.
2. Select from the dropdown list beside Function.
3. Finally click on **Save**.

#### How do I add a Group Function?

This is done from the **Groups Page** and is easy to set up.

Here's how:

1. From a group page click on **edit** beside a persons name. (At this point it does not matter who)
2. Click on the + icon beside Function field.
3. Click on **Add Group Function** and type the name or heading, describing the function e.g. Intern
4. Click **Save**.
5. Click **Close**.
6. To add more functions repeat steps 3-4.
7. When finished click **Save**.
